你查询的IP:[121.4.43.246]  地理位置:中国–上海–上海

最新查询119.128.51.8 218.140.68.73 221.8.169.7 125.98.13.112 60.160.132.235 120.52.93.187 124.249.157.128 119.4.107.103 121.192.103.183 121.4.43.246 119.62.235.28 203.174.96.118 169.211.1.27 116.208.51.207 119.75.208.11 114.28.151.98 222.32.120.64 124.240.124.133 220.152.128.67 134.196.103.129 203.176.168.57 221.136.99.58 202.153.48.173 119.10.24.127 119.27.160.157 203.171.224.197 203.88.192.124 203.128.32.187 202.38.138.187 210.51.254.36 117.128.118.34